New England: Brides' march against domestic violence

From Lawrence, MA, the North Andover Eagle Tribune reports,

Women dressed in bridal gowns, and men, many clad in black, walked from
114 Plaza to Campagnone Common on Saturday to mourn victims of domestic
violence. The 150 walkers in the seventh annual Brides' March were
joined by Miss Massachusetts 2009, Amanda Kelly.

Candles were lit as the names of victims of domestic violence were read. [...]
The ceremony concluded the walk, which is held annually in memory of Gladys Ricart, a Dominican immigrant, who was murdered on her wedding day by her estranged boyfriend 10 years ago in New Jersey. ... more
